Exactly how do I recognize when my pipelines have ruptured?


Varying water stress


Pipes do not simply burst in a day. You might have discovered that your kitchen tap or shower doesn't run right away when you turn the tap. It may stop for a couple of secs and after that blast you with more pressure than usual.
In various other instances, the water might seem normal in the beginning, then decrease in pressure after a few seconds.

Infected water


Lots of people presume a burst pipeline is a one-way electrical outlet. Rather the contrary. As water drains of the hole or wound in your plumbing system, pollutants find their way in.
Your water may be polluted from the resource, so if you can, check if your water container has any kind of troubles. Nevertheless, if your alcohol consumption water is provided as well as cleansed by the city government, you should call your plumber right away if you see or smell anything funny in your water.

Puddles under pipelines as well as sinks


When a pipe bursts, the outflow develops a puddle. It may appear that the pool is growing in size, and also despite the number of times you mop the puddle, in a couple of minutes, there's another one waiting to be cleaned. Usually, you may not have the ability to trace the pool to any kind of visible pipelines. This is a sign to call a professional plumber.

Wet walls and water discolorations


Before a pipeline ruptureds, it will leakage, most times. If this persistent leaking goes unnoticed, the leakage might graduate right into a large laceration in your pipe. One very easy way to prevent this emergency is to watch out for wet wall surfaces advertisement water stains. These water discolorations will lead you right to the leakage.

Untraceable leaking noises


Pipeline bursts can take place in one of the most undesirable places, like within concrete, inside walls, or under sinks. When your home goes silent, you might be able to listen to an irritatingly relentless leaking noise. Even after you have actually checked your shower head and also kitchen area tap, the trickling might proceed.
Precious visitor, the dripping might be originating from a pipe inside your walls. There isn't much you can do concerning that, except inform an expert plumber.

What do I do when I spot a ruptured pipeline?


Your water meter will remain to run even while your water wastes. To decrease your losses, find the primary controls and turn the supply off. The water pipe are an above-ground structure at the edge of your residential or commercial property.

First, let’s talk about frozen pipes. Every winter, our experts here at JD Service Now, Heating, and Air Conditioning are called in on frozen pipe jobs that need immediate service. Frozen pipes happen because pipes are exposed or hose bibbs aren’t properly winterized. We’re also seen some instances where homeowners forgot to clear out and shut off their sprinkler systems at the end of the summer the result is not pretty! When water is left standing in a pipeline over the course of the hard North Carolina winter, it freezes and expands. If it expands too quickly before the homeowner realizes there’s a problem, it can burst the pipe and require emergency plumbing pipe repair.



But frozen pipes can be avoided! Just follow these three tips to winterize your home and keep your plumbing safe:


Get an Insulation Blanket for the Hot Water Heater



Having a water heater leak can make a serious mess: if you don’t have an automatic shut-off valve on the device, the storage tank will continue trying to fill itself. Avoid disaster this winter by taking extra precautions. You can buy an insulating blanket for your hot water tank at your local hardware store for less than $50, and the investment could save you hundreds in water damage repairs!


Shut Down Sprinkler Systems


Before we transition into the bitter cold of winter, do this simple check: have you winterized your sprinkler system? You probably haven’t thought about watering your lawn since the summer ended, but it’s still important to put some time into completely closing the water supply valve and then clearing out the water from the pipes. This involves blowing compressed air through the sprinkler lines to ensure there’s no standing water left to freeze.


Heat-Taping on Exposed Pipes


An easy way to prevent frozen pipes is heat taping, which you can do on your own. Electrical heating tape is cheap, and if you insulate your exposed pipes with it before the temperature drops, you can greatly decrease your risk.
